#540954 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#540954 is composed of 32.9% red, 3.5% green and 32.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 89.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 67.1% black. It has a hue angle of 300 degrees, a saturation of 80.6% and a lightness of 18.2%. #540954 color hex could be obtained by blending #a812a8 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660066.

Shades and Tints of #540954
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d010d is the darkest color, while #fffaff is the lightest one.
